    3. This is part of Pamela's line. Martha V. Rall dau of Jacob Christopher Columbus Ralls William G. Cutler, History of the State of Kansas. Smith County, Part 2. Daniel H. Fleming, Superintendent of Public Instruction, came to Smith County in April, 1873, and engaged in Agriculture. Was elected County Superintendent in the fall of 1880; re-elected in the fall of 1882. Was born in Moultrie County, ILL., March 17, 1840. Lived in that and Shelby counties, until 1847, and moved with his parents to Davis County, Ia., where he was raised and educated. He began teaching in 1859, and has followed that occupation more or less since. He enlisted in the spring of 1861 in Company G, Second Iowa Volunteer Infantry, and participated in all the battles of his command, Promoted to Second Lieutenant. Mustered out in the spring of 1864, on account of expiration of term of service. After army life he returned home and followed farming, stock-raising and teaching. He was married in the spring of 1865 to Miss Martha V. Rall, of Drakesville, Iowa. They have eight children - Warren E., Willie O., Lillis A., Festus R., Levi R (deceased), Beulah, Fenton and Flora. They are members of the Christian church. He is a member of Anderson Post, No. 47, G.A.R. Nancy Lohbrunner lohbrunner@prodigy.net
